Change... ...climate change impacts to better protect
lives and property and ensure they can continue to offer a good quality of life and a thriving economy
now and in the future. This publication can help local government officials, staff, and boards find
strategies to prepare for climate change impacts through land use and building policies. The policy
options described here bring multiple short- and long-term environmental, economic, health, and societal
benefits that can not only prepare a community and its residents and businesses for the impacts of climate
change...
